The dyno was used to tune each car and truck after assembly.
You must be registered for see images


Steve explains how each car is dismanteled, rebuilt, refitted with performance parts and body panels, and all done by hand. Here he tears into a soon-to-be-supercharged Mustang engine.

I learned all kinds of trivia about Chrysler and the work they did. Did you know Chrysler bought the plant from the estate of the Dodge brothers after they both died of influenza in the 1919 pandemic? Also, Chrysler switched to a war footing and ceased production of cars in favor of jeeps and tanks during WWII. This tank engine is a series of 5 in-line sixes bolted to a common crank. It produced 445 HP from a total of 1250 CID. No word on torque, but this baby powered Shermans, so you bet it was badass!
